William Kim Bio

Will Kim is a member of the firm’s Corporate & Tax Practice Group where he focuses on advising private equity sponsors, private and public companies and entrepreneurs on the purchase and sale sides of mergers and acquisitions, corporate and commercial transactions, equity and debt arrangements, corporate governance, and company formations. He has also advised clients from a diverse range of industries, including technology, healthcare, telecommunications, industrial services, building solutions and construction, franchising, restaurants and retail, consumer products, frozen foods and snack foods, advertising and marketing, education, and hospitality. As a business focused attorney, Will offers his clients sound legal advice and strategic guidance, helping them to achieve their business objectives. He has extensive experience drafting and negotiating complex corporate, transactional and commercial agreements, managing legal and corporate governance concerns, and advising clients throughout their business cycle. Will has previously served as General Counsel for a large multinational managed technology solutions corporation and built the legal department and compliance regime for the company. With this experience, Will possesses a deep understanding of the concerns and challenges of technology businesses and corporate clients. While in this role, Will regularly advised C-level and divisional executives on all aspects of business operations, acquisitions and growth strategy, litigation, environmental and social concerns, regulatory compliance, and corporate governance. Outside of work, Will is an active member of several civic and community organizations. He has served as former member of the Board of Directors for the Korean American League for Civic Action (KALCA) and the former Action Council Co-Chair of the Coalition for Asian American Children and Families (CACF).
